Transaction 5c93ff38191684cc4ebfd9d69f2f653de67ab8e5effb4ae0fa5021c6b250de05
1 Input
1 Output
-
5c93ff38191684cc4ebfd9d69f2f653de67ab8e5effb4ae0fa5021c6b250de05:0
- value
- 107698136
- script pubkey
- OP_0 OP_PUSHBYTES_20 073be9c4db5ccb86f0bdd82994a5deb5223594ab
- address
- bc1qqua7n3xmtn9cdu9amq5effw7k53rt99t5ngs98